Background technique
As everyone knows, display system is held a conference or consultation in comprehensive analysis, meeting, the effect of man-machine interaction comprehensively in the system such as commander is essential, and touch type liquid crystal display is as to main output and the interactive mode of studying and judging personnel's display, between its viewing mode, have influence on the actual meeting experience of participant.General in intelligent meeting system, usually use the LCD Panel that the structure of liquid crystal display is fixed position and angle, take desktop area impact attractive in appearance, meanwhile, participant cannot adjust suitable viewing location.A kind of LCD Panel mounting type more novel is by comparison liquid crystal elevator, and when needing to use display screen, the lift being hidden in conference table inside is raised to table surface display screen below meeting; When not using display screen, lift declines automatically, and display screen is hidden in conference table inside.This mode can make meeting desktop smooth attractive in appearance, but cannot fixing display, because rear portion is without support, easily causes and rocks.The touch screen demonstration device in the system of studying and judging cannot be used.Because of load-bearing problem, study and judge host computer and also cannot be installed on liquid crystal elevator.
Market usually has for studying and judging system chambers liquid crystal display installation method:
Fixed installation: this installation method cannot realize the position of liquid crystal display and the switching of viewing angle, in actual use, watcher, because the difference of position, height etc., adjusts the position of display device and angle.
Liquid crystal elevator is installed: when needing to use display screen, the lift being hidden in conference table inside is raised to table surface display screen below meeting; When not using display screen, lift declines automatically, and display screen is hidden in conference table inside.This mode rising or falling speed is comparatively slow, and angle adjustable is limited, holding axle means of rolling, producing larger noise, take meeting desktop in lifting process because adopting.Affect the effect of meeting and demonstration.Because of Product Process problem, this life-span solving liquid crystal elevator is often not long.

Embodiment 1
Refer to Fig. 1-Fig. 8, in the utility model embodiment, one can control liquid crystal display panel invertor, and comprise casing 2, upset touch display 4 and control circuit, casing 2 is made up of cabinet front plate, after panel box, box bottom and box cover.After panel box is made up of casing backboard 7 and two box sides 6, support beam 5 is also provided with in the middle of casing backboard 7, and the top connect box cover plate of support beam 5, the below connect box base plate of support beam 5, the top of support beam 5 is also provided with trip shaft 3, upset touch display 4 is arranged on by trip shaft 3 on the after panel box of casing 2, box cover adopts hollow structure inside, upset touch display 4 embeds in the hollow structure inside of box cover, the middle part of casing 2 is provided with control circuit, and the bottom of casing 2 is provided with the mainframe box 1 holding host computer.
Refer to Fig. 9, control circuit comprises control switch, relay and snubber.Control switch comprises rotating forward switch and reversal switch, and relay is made up of relay K 1 and relay K 2, and snubber comprises two limit switches.The one end rotating forward switch connects relay K 1, rotate forward the DC24V end of the other end connecting valve power supply of switch, one end of reversal switch connects relay K 2, the DC24V end of the other end connecting valve power supply of reversal switch, the DC24V of relay K 1 and relay K 2 also direct connecting valve power supply holds, one end of relay K 1 and one end common ground of relay K 2, relay K 1 connects one end of motor by a limit switch, relay K 2 connects the other end of motor by another limit switch, two limit switches also with the other end of relay K 1, the other end common ground of relay K 2.The live wire of switch power, zero line, bottom line connect upset touch display 4 and main frame respectively, and live wire is also connected with safety fuse cutout with before main frame at access upset touch display 4.
The utility model uses control switch to control the direct current of a clockwise and anticlockwise, by reliable electric discharge, direct current energy is converted to the mechanical energy that upset touch display 4 overturns, realizes the mechanical opening and closing of upset touch display 4.The position of upset uses the spacing limit method two with mechanical position limitation of circuit, reaches suitable angle to control upset touch display 4.By Control upset touch display 4 mechanical overturn and opening and closing, realization is held when studying and judging meeting and is turn on desktop by upset touch display 4, be provided with the angle viewing that the personnel that study and judge are comfortable, the structural formula of Simultaneous Stabilization is studied and judged personnel and can be carried out the operations such as touch to upset touch display 4.
When using the utility model, relay is utilized upwards to be overturn by trip shaft 3 by upset touch display 4.Finish using, upset touch display 4 is overturn downwards by trip shaft 3 by recycling relay, upset touch display 4 can be closed in casing 2.
The utility model is owing to taking above technological scheme, and it has the following advantages:
1, save desk-top space, only having when needing the occasion studied and judged and touch just to need upset touch display 4 to flip out, then closing in table at ordinary times, becoming common conference room.
2, adjustable angle, according to the situations such as watcher position, height and the various angles of display of environment customisations studying and judging room, can ensure that entirety studies and judges effect.
3, overturn structure is stablized, and is more suitable for touch screen, and the utility model adopts overturn structure, and can be upset touch display 4 and provide good support, structure is more stable.
